mysql主鍵可以為空嗎?

藏色散人
發布: 2020-09-14 15:19:07
原創
22141 人瀏覽過

mysql主鍵不可以為空,因為當建立或變更表格時可以透過定義「PRIMARY KEY」約束來建立主鍵,而一個表格只能有一個主鍵約束,且主鍵約束中的欄位不能是空值,由於主鍵約束確保唯一數據,所以經常來定義識別列。

mysql主鍵可以為空嗎?

資料庫主鍵是指表中一個欄位或欄位的組合,其值能夠唯一的識別表中的每一個行。這樣的一列或多列成為表的主鍵,透過它可以強製表的實體完整性。當創建或更改表時可以透過定義PRIMARY KEY約束來建立主鍵,一個表只能有一個主鍵約束,而且主鍵約束中的列不能是空值,由於主鍵約束確保唯一數據,所一經常來定義標識列。

主鍵的作用:

1、 從上面的定義可以看出,主鍵是用來唯一標識資料庫表中一行資料的。

2、 作為一個可以被外鍵有效引用的物件。

那麼mysql主鍵可以為空嗎?

注意!主鍵永遠不能為空值!

以上是mysql主鍵可以為空嗎?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

相關標籤:
來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板
關於我們 免責聲明 Sitemap
PHP中文網:公益線上PHP培訓,幫助PHP學習者快速成長!